Original Description
In Hua Yan’s Hua Nie Shan Shui Ce, delicate ink washes and brisk brushstrokes conjure a dreamlike mountainscape brimming with poetic spontaneity. A standout masterpiece of Qing Dynasty "eccentric" painting, Hua’s album leaves fuse literati refinement with playful rebellion—where mist-clad peaks dissolve into empty space, and agile lines dance between representation and abstraction. Created during the 18th century when orthodox styles dominated, Hua Yan’s work subverted rigid conventions through his signature "xiaopian jing" (whimsical vignettes), earning him recognition as one of the "Eight Eccentrics of Yangzhou." The album’s intimate scale invites close contemplation, revealing his mastery in balancing void and substance, a testament to Daoist harmony that influenced later ink modernists like Fu Baoshi.
